Output 2ea1599cede5c1000cf842eddca86bc9bea6d5d272208afabb7e5638fe0740df:0

value
88537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c62f93fe46cf76d137d336badc067440637f5323 OP_EQUAL
address
3KkviJxY6VYgPbtLdfQekq3MbUQLMZc8sa
transaction
2ea1599cede5c1000cf842eddca86bc9bea6d5d272208afabb7e5638fe0740df
confirmations
19697
spent
true